The Digital Dawn: The Legacy of the Acorn Electron

In the vibrant landscape of 1980s computing, where the boundaries of imagination were being redrawn by silicon and code, there emerged a figure of profound technological influence known as the acorn electron. While often viewed through the lens of hardware history, to the enthusiast, this entity represents a pivotal era of British innovation. Emerging from the creative laboratories of Acorn Computers Ltd., the Electron was conceived not merely as a machine, but as a bridge between the high-end educational power of the BBC Micro and the burgeoning home computing market. It arrived on the scene on August 25, 1983, carrying with it a promise of accessibility, priced at an inviting £199, designed to bring the magic of bitmapped graphics and complex logic into the living rooms of the United Kingdom.

The essence of this era was defined by a unique blend of limitation and ingenuity. The acorn electron operated within a delicate ecosystem of 8-bit architecture, utilizing the Synertek SY6502A processor to weave digital tapestries. Its technical composition was a masterclass in efficient design, featuring 32 kilobytes of RAM and a ROM that housed the beloved BBC BASIC II. There was a certain poetic rhythm to its operation; users would engage with the machine through the tactile, auditory experience of loading programs via audio cassette tapes, a process that required patience and a deep connection to the physical medium. This era of computing was not about instant gratification but about the slow, beautiful unfolding of data through magnetic tape.

A Symphony of Expansion and Innovation

As the narrative of the acorn electron progressed, it demonstrated an extraordinary capacity for growth and adaptation. It was never a static entity; rather, it was a platform that invited expansion and evolution. Through the introduction of specialized hardware like the Plus 1 and Plus 3 expansion units, the machine transformed. The Plus 1 brought with it the tactile joy of analog joysticks and parallel ports, while the Plus 3 introduced the sophisticated capability of disk drives, fundamentally altering how users interacted with software and data. This ability to expand its horizons mirrored the very spirit of the 8-bit revolution—a period where a single machine could grow from a simple educational tool into a robust station for gaming and complex computation.

The visual language of this period was equally captivating. The Electron was capable of rendering diverse graphical modes, ranging from high-resolution monochrome to vibrant, multi-color bitmapped displays. Whether connected to a standard television set or a professional RGB monitor, the machine projected a window into new worlds. This versatility allowed for a rich tapestry of software development, where developers pushed the limits of 160x256 and 320x256 resolutions to create immersive gaming experiences that would define a generation of British youth.

Historical Significance and Enduring Impact

The historical weight of the acorn electron cannot be overstated. At its peak, it was reportedly the best-selling microcomputer in the United Kingdom, with sales estimates reaching between 200,000 and 250,000 units. Even as Acorn ceased production in 1985, the spirit of the Electron refused to fade. A resilient community of developers and enthusiasts emerged, sustaining a vibrant software market and ensuring that the legacy of the BBC Micro lineage continued to thrive long after the hardware itself had transitioned into the realm of nostalgia.

Today, we look back at this period not just as a chapter in technological history, but as a foundational movement in the digital arts. The acorn electron stands as a symbol of an era when computing was personal, experimental, and deeply connected to the physical world. Its influence can be felt in the DNA of modern computing architectures and in the hearts of those who remember the soft whir of a tape drive and the glow of a cathode-ray tube. It remains a cherished classic, a testament to the power of accessible innovation and the enduring allure of the 8-bit dream.
